Chapter 133

The fire started in one of the prison cells, set ablaze by the warden who was colluding with the gang. Meanwhile, orchestrated fights broke out to divert the attention of other wardens.

The warden, who was supposed to help them escape, came and unlocked the prison door for them.

As the fire spread, some of the other wardens had no other choice but to open the cell doors to prevent the criminals from suffocating.

Seizing the opportunity amidst the chaos, Alex, and his accomplices rushed out of the cell. They got to the fence where they were supposed to jump over and smiles brimmed on their faces.

“I'll go first,” Dimitrus said, and began climbing the fence. The guards that used to be around were also distracted because of the fire.

“Go faster, you follow!” the warden urged, pointing at Alex.

The others who were supposed to escape joined them and Alex knew that their escape could get jeopardized. He quickly got close to the iron-made fence and fixed his fingers into the holes.
